Summary: "Cats in the Museum" is a heartwarming comedy that follows the adventures of a group of mischievous felines who find themselves unexpectedly trapped in a prestigious art museum after hours. As the cats explore the various galleries and exhibits, they inadvertently cause chaos and mayhem, leading to a series of hilarious mishaps and misunderstandings. The movie explores themes of friendship, problem-solving, and the unexpected joys that can arise from embracing the unexpected. Set against the backdrop of the museum's stunning architecture and renowned artworks, the film offers a delightful and whimsical take on the relationship between humans and their feline companions.
